Hi ALL
I got a problem like, i have configured a ignite server [9000/826/E45]. Made all the config file and depots available.
The problem is when i try to give the command
bootsys -a -f -v -i "HP-UX B.11.11 ALL_LOCALS" test40
nothing will happen, it's simply hangs. And also when i try from
1) sea lan install
2) bo 15.70.175.213 then itself it's hanging. So i thought that my be some network related issues, so i have changed a network cable as well as network port twice but
still i am facing the same problem.

Can anybody help out in this issues.

There are a limited set of network interfaces supported - check the FAQ at http://www.software.hp.com/products/IUX/index.html

To verify you have a good installation you could try the "bootstrap" approach by running make_boot_tape and booting from this tape to find your Ignite server. If that works then the issue is probably that bootp is not configured correctly or not supported for your client.
